Hardie vs. Cedar Siding in Portland: Durability, Maintenance, and Cost

Hardie Siding with Cedar Accent.

If you live in Portland, your siding is basically in a long-term relationship with moisture. Months of rain, damp shade on north-facing walls, moss growth, and that on-and-off freeze cycle mean the differences between siding materials show up fast.
